Commit graph

434 commits

Author SHA1 Message Date
Deokgyu Yang
95d6cc0dde gts3l: Remove installing su package
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I328a3d2b436bca854aa28e7232f88fa28a2915a1
2021-05-27 02:16:41 +09:00
Deokgyu Yang
2952db2072 gts3l: livedisplay: Disable livedisplay for now
Not working livedisplay causes random reboots and reduces performance
significantly. But I do want to get it back working with correct display
calibration.

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Ibf240145cec41bf3529b9ae084935b824ed4dfdb
2021-05-27 00:55:27 +09:00
Deokgyu Yang
af3b53e1f3 gts3l: camera: Move camera configurations to under the vendor
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Ia1caebc03f9a4e36707abe4c7733f9caf094f598
2021-05-26 23:41:43 +09:00
Deokgyu Yang
6ebe95d37d gts3l: radio: Add missing HAL and its manifest definition
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Iaaecae6adeeb382cc27ea998e7046a0adc18ada5
2021-05-26 22:46:29 +09:00
Deokgyu Yang
5298bd5eac gts3l: Fix typo that had not actual effect
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Ib50a4f6561811daf0328f81762250d577eb2a28f
2021-05-26 22:46:29 +09:00
Deokgyu Yang
cd4e627243 Revert "gts3l: firmware: Do not move firmwares to under vendor dir"
This reverts commit 7ac194f522.
2021-05-26 22:46:29 +09:00
Deokgyu Yang
f6521cdd94 Revert "gts3l: debug: Remove unnecessary binaries put just for debugging"
This reverts commit 8df9e3ea8a.
2021-05-26 22:46:29 +09:00
Deokgyu Yang
e71c568711 gts3l: radio: Remove override flag
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I463dd05bedf30e012ad1f0e21465974b83616fec
2021-05-26 22:46:29 +09:00
Deokgyu Yang
700866f5f5 Revert "gts3l: audio: Board also uses generic audio"
This reverts commit dc33b0f051.
2021-05-26 22:46:29 +09:00
Deokgyu Yang
d4d7275cfd gts3l: Use libcutils-v29.so for libsec-ril.so
Contents from LineageOS/samsung_gts4lv-common, lineage-18.1

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I2e288bd174bda36e99fd9bf3922987eb69593b7b
2021-05-26 22:46:29 +09:00
Deokgyu Yang
da2dc83895 gts3l: camera, audio: Add few more libraries that seems might be needed
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I76f4a9cd8c33f8e614c414e1d18df3991e77c5a1
2021-05-26 22:46:27 +09:00
Deokgyu Yang
dc33b0f051 gts3l: audio: Board also uses generic audio
This board should only use ALSA audio I think but doesn't work so far. So
adding support generic audio is just for an test. Might be reverted later.

Acutally, it seems they shouldn't be set at the same time.

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I16569fa3f5b481387437c532f137950ef9564e7f
2021-05-26 09:53:10 +09:00
Deokgyu Yang
296ac19157 gts3l: adsprpcd: Try to import previous settings but it doesn't work
Keep it exists because it is not harmful

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I919ea9ff8480d017e2958f53d82f3715420a7964
2021-05-26 03:16:36 +09:00
Deokgyu Yang
d34c631c9f gts3l: overlay: Edit as much as I can understand for now
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Ia00dbff6c0bd65c7e2f1c9f2df20ee1d875df1f8
2021-05-26 03:16:36 +09:00
Deokgyu Yang
cabcaa639d gts3l: overlay: Replace overlay files with from gts4lv
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I9b486555f02972559e604facfa3412c519ae51ac
2021-05-26 03:16:36 +09:00
Deokgyu Yang
39bde0e271 gts3l: livedisplay: Add three more interfaces to prevent from aborting
Don't know why these are needed

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I35cf90babc9a16e183724481f24e4e37d16f7ed4
2021-05-26 03:16:22 +09:00
Deokgyu Yang
7351423128 gts3l: composer: Do not set passthrough mode
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I2a8264749dddf7f698e88933597bb21c0a6e3d53
2021-05-26 02:15:39 +09:00
Deokgyu Yang
79c38449ad Revert "gts3l: audio: Add some packages"
This reverts commit 032cb8a687.
2021-05-26 01:42:19 +09:00
Deokgyu Yang
1fa0a80b77 gts3l: hidl: Build android.hidl.manager
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I426628fcdf4088ad84ad7379c43ab981cc1e895a
2021-05-26 01:19:23 +09:00
Deokgyu Yang
1be537d1ff gts3l: hidl: Enforce VINTF manifest override
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Ifa645ce7590fad73e7516da5e7c02e8fd73ce84a
2021-05-26 01:14:48 +09:00
Deokgyu Yang
9a3aaf5fa1 gts3l: init: Remove unused hwcomposer-2-2
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I9efab22dbb2db69d1ea307891e3a6834e8ca9dc2
2021-05-26 01:12:05 +09:00
Deokgyu Yang
d8aceaee49 gts3l: health: Migrate to Health 2.1 HAL
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I74e179cfb35cd560e8b3e85819613882dd69533d
2021-05-25 23:35:41 +09:00
Deokgyu Yang
0464a57010 gts3l: wifi: Remove some Wifi related HIDL entries from manifest
Because it has its own VINT fragment

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Icc32c7769c20ced1173760ee5235f2a35f159a99
2021-05-25 10:33:10 +09:00
Deokgyu Yang
802980c77a gts3l: display: Fix typo
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I2feff4e6ed621caccc9e4f467d08f4b1b5d87cc9
2021-05-25 10:33:10 +09:00
Deokgyu Yang
032cb8a687 gts3l: audio: Add some packages
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I120234a9f6433e0c7da2f6708c4982cc11f9ecd6
2021-05-25 10:33:10 +09:00
Deokgyu Yang
954eb272f9 gts3l: qcom: Add vndfwk detect with some properties
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Iff192992c8b19c1eb44170c4b04b7e7f5b65b292
2021-05-25 10:33:07 +09:00
Deokgyu Yang
7ac194f522 gts3l: firmware: Do not move firmwares to under vendor dir
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Ibbf5569f507b813c21c096493b4931e93eba7ec3
2021-05-25 01:06:24 +09:00
Deokgyu Yang
ae5165d075 gts3l: init: Update audio HAL service to fir into the current setup
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I5367a7bcd715a6c0a1a1394da65bfb83b2b35835
2021-05-25 01:06:24 +09:00
Deokgyu Yang
08aa033353 gts3l: Fix symbol error with libwvhidl
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I92264a5094ae6a5d05a589349f0007f21e01c02c
2021-05-25 01:06:24 +09:00
Deokgyu Yang
12c4f62ac2 gts3l: power: Change power binary version to 1.0
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I0963f36b36992b65039addbb3eea3991647bd021
2021-05-25 01:06:15 +09:00
Deokgyu Yang
ce2634d1f0 gts3l: Fix build error
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I3d42609f3d7d7d63bb7b6394bddcb3afea671d91
2021-05-25 00:25:57 +09:00
Deokgyu Yang
1e8ecc4ad6 gts3l: bluetooth: Don't know why I did this
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Id863fae16b50d1757ce95ed667943e290fe4f3d8
2021-05-24 22:26:15 +09:00
Deokgyu Yang
8e7f2eebf9 gts3l: usb: Import USB HAL and it contains vinf itself
The USB HAL is from LineageOS/samsung_gts4lv-common, lineage-18.1

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I4800a5ccffcab78a1ac2e5605c6df37ad785b763
2021-05-24 22:24:25 +09:00
Deokgyu Yang
9baf6e066b gts3l: timeservice: Cert doesn't exist anymore
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Ib249cf553c3591c9e66323b340321898d78f248a
2021-05-24 22:24:25 +09:00
Deokgyu Yang
8df9e3ea8a gts3l: debug: Remove unnecessary binaries put just for debugging
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Ib365095f9d333b6094115c074bbef67ae3c87edf
2021-05-24 22:24:25 +09:00
Deokgyu Yang
0eba9d263b gts3l: tools: Update tools to fit into LineageOS 18.1
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I69ef2cb53c73382d02e54937cb3981b3e7d80196
2021-05-24 22:24:25 +09:00
Deokgyu Yang
4f4f2e20b3 gts3l: init: Should not indented here
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
2021-05-24 22:24:25 +09:00
Deokgyu Yang
a34f76efda gts3l: selinux: Rename base sepolicy makefile
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
2021-05-24 22:24:25 +09:00
Deokgyu Yang
afcee8f4c9 gts3l: power: Use hardware.perf 2.0 for some reason for R
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
2021-05-24 22:24:25 +09:00
Deokgyu Yang
45aa37fb80 gts3l: drm: Update DRM version to 1.3
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
2021-05-24 22:24:25 +09:00
Deokgyu Yang
4022c27a49 gts3l: hidl: Remove manager and replace makefile with blueprint
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
2021-05-24 22:24:25 +09:00
Deokgyu Yang
d1885ea0d9 gts3l: gatekeeper: Build only 64bit impl
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
2021-05-24 22:24:25 +09:00
Deokgyu Yang
662ebb73be gts3l: bluetooth: Build things to do with bluetooth audio
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
2021-05-24 22:24:25 +09:00
Deokgyu Yang
18798ae484 gts3l: camera: Import camera HAL
The camera HAL is from LineageOS/xiaomi_msm8996-common, lineage-18.1

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I5241f82e9ebbb4076eaf73a4180b65e9124c66c4
2021-05-24 22:24:23 +09:00
Deokgyu Yang
30d19ccaa9 gts3l: camera: Remove vendor.samsung providers and add android impls from firmware
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Ia2898f9420c324361f23474cda9e874622a7edd0
2021-05-24 22:06:31 +09:00
Deokgyu Yang
c9e11e6ed8 gts3l: camera: Remove 64bit libraries
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
2021-05-24 17:20:05 +09:00
Deokgyu Yang
460f1f95b9 gts3l: audio: Replace config file with modified one and add patched HAL
The audio HAL is from LineageOS/samsung_gts4lv-common, lineage-18.1

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
2021-05-24 17:20:04 +09:00
Deokgyu Yang
d1a5bc18c7 gts3l: audio: (WIP) Build only for 32 bit and remove unsupported flags
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: Iae8c799af7af6ae39bf46e70389f14cd72448d36
2021-05-23 13:37:01 +09:00
Deokgyu Yang
3aeb8a59f2 gts3l: audio: (WIP) Add hidden audio config file
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I6de8ad652b03f4a45dff3563b3220392f0e0076d
2021-05-23 00:58:08 +09:00
Deokgyu Yang
cee7a19ab8 gts3l: camera: (WIP) Add missing libmm-qcamera
Signed-off-by: Deokgyu Yang <secugyu@gmail.com>
Change-Id: I69dd7ebba80f7552ebed73d1e9baa8d38d04d1fd
2021-05-22 23:46:09 +09:00